As a responsible pet owner, you should get copies of the puppy’s medical history from the breeder or its parents. Once you’ve purchased a puppy, take it to the vet immediately. Visits to the vet can cost anywhere from $35 to $50. Annual immunizations cost anywhere from $14 to $25.

The Boston Terrier price range can range anywhere from $550 to $1,400.

The average Boston terrier price is about $850, with most puppies priced between that range. Purchasing a puppy is a great investment, but the price can be high.
